Your theory hinges upon Rand drawing on Saidin and the TP together, or being in a circle where the TP and Saidar are used together. But RJ has said that the TP and the OP have unpredictable reactions together. We also have the crossing balefire streams as evidence for this. Which makes it highly unlikely someone can channel both and survive. That is, if one person can access two sourcesb of power at the same time in the first place!
So quite apart from the thematic issues others pointed to, there are practical issues with your idea too.
Anyway, you're taking the wrong message from Rand's statement about having to touch the DO last time. The solution is not: touch him with something else. The solution is to not touch him at all.

The most likely solution is to use a well so that while your sealing the DO and therefore touching him, he is only able to pollute the well, leaving saidar-saidin clean.
It's probably why Sanderson said that he was surprised at how much foreshadowing was in TEOTH. When you add Moiraine comment in the book about the purpose of the eye:
“It might be called the essence of saidin.” The Aes Sedai’s words echoed round the dome. “The essence of the male half of the True Source, the pure essence of the Power wielded by men before the Time of Madness. The Power to mend the seal on the Dark One’s prison, or to break it open completely.”
We know that Moiraine was almost always wrong when she was sure of something, but often correct when guessing, this is probably one of those good guess.
